No not really, but if you read some posts on here others have been on their third set by that mileage 🥴 I would be disappointed to need rear pads at anything less than 10k and fronts 15k/20k miles.
 
Well it was 4 sets 3700 miles and a set of fronts , new rear caliper and rear disc . Sold it now as frustrated . Gone back to Ducati V4s. Shame as it was a great bike to ride but found the brakes lacking in both wear and feel . The V4 has fantastic brakes. I feel the old 1250 brakes were way better in hindsight.
 
Well mine made it to NordKapp just after the visitor centre closed at 1am this morning. 3300 miles since leaving Morayshire in a fraction under 2 weeks; a bit bum numbing at times, but the bike (and the SHAD luggage) has performed faultlessly. Anakee Road tyres performing well as well, working in all weathers and living up to their 90/10 billing. Slightly shorter route home, a mere 3000 miles to do in just 8 days.

I have 4500 miles .i did have starting problems.But now resolved . The auto ride height has played up twice and is going in at the end of the month to have an all new system including front and rear units and new pump and hoses fitted approx £3500 . So bmw stands by its products. Coming from 3 1250 i am impressed except for the seat . Which i will have done in the winter
